    Default Missing lug nut.

    I have just noticed I have a missing lug nut on my passenger front wheel. My car has been back on the road for just over a year now after I returned from living overseas during which time my brother drove it a bit and it sat in the garage for 6 months. During this time someone has managed to strip the christ out of the stud and lose a nut. I have obviously been driving like this for a year now as I have had no reason to take off the centre cap. My question is can the missing nut have caused any damage to my rim and can it have anything to do with my steering pulling to the left?

    Maybe do a bit more investigation into why it has a stripped thread and a missing nut which could indicate a hard hit to the curb on the passenger side. You'd need to replace the stud and nut (easy) and then
    check the front tyres to see if there is any unusual wear (which there probably will be!) and then get a wheel alignment. How big is your brother?

    If it was not you I would be speaking to your brother about the stripped stud and missing nut and no missing 1 nut wont make your car pull to the left if you havent rotated your tyres in a year they are prob just worn and thats why it is starting to pull to the left.
